Video Transcript

"Now we'll demonstrate a cross cut technique utilizing the sliding table. For this again I have to leave you for a moment, start up the machine and please pay attention, always wear your safety glasses. And there you are, there is your cut off technique. Remember what I told you before, never under any circumstances, you cut the wood against the fence, always utilize the cutoff table, the sliding table. Thank You."
